"Executive Summary Low-Carbon Propulsion Market: Growth Trends and Share Breakdown
The global low-carbon propulsion market size was valued at USD 24.31 billion in 2024 and is expected to reach USD 115.83 billion by 2032, at a CAGR of 21.55% during the forecast period. Increasing preferences of the consumer towards the usages of emission free vehicles and energy efficient transport, volatility in the prices of fuel and vehicle conversions, adoption of stringent regulations on emissions along with increasing trends to reduce emissions are some of the major as well vital factors which will likely to augment the growth of the low-carbon propulsion market

Low-Carbon Propulsion Market Summary
Segments
- By Fuel Type: The low-carbon propulsion market can be segmented based on fuel type into electric, hydrogen, biofuel, and others. Electric propulsion systems are witnessing significant growth due to the increasing focus on reducing carbon emissions and transitioning towards sustainable energy sources. Hydrogen propulsion systems are also gaining traction as they offer zero emissions during operation, making them an attractive option for various industries. Biofuels are being increasingly used to power vehicles and reduce the dependency on fossil fuels, thus contributing to lower carbon footprint.
- By Vehicle Type: In terms of vehicle type, the market can be segmented into passenger vehicles, commercial vehicles, and others. Passenger vehicles are leading the adoption of low-carbon propulsion systems, driven by the growing awareness among consumers regarding environmental issues and the benefits of using cleaner technologies. Commercial vehicles such as buses and trucks are also witnessing a shift towards low-carbon propulsion to comply with stringent emission regulations and reduce operating costs.
- By Region: Geographically, the global low-carbon propulsion market can be segmented into North America, Europe, Asia Pacific, Latin America, and the Middle East & Africa. North America and Europe are at the forefront of adopting low-carbon propulsion technologies, supported by favorable government policies and incentives to promote sustainable transportation solutions. Asia Pacific is emerging as a key market for low-carbon propulsion due to the rapid urbanization, increasing vehicle ownership, and need for cleaner mobility solutions in countries like China and India.
Market Players
- Tesla, Inc.: Known for its electric vehicles and innovative battery technology, Tesla remains a key player in the low-carbon propulsion market, driving the shift towards sustainable transportation solutions globally.
- Toyota Motor Corporation: Toyota has been a pioneer in hybrid vehicles and continues to invest in fuel cell technology, positioning itself as a leading player in the development of low-carbon propulsion systems.
- BYD Company Limited: Specializing in electric vehicles and batteries, BYD has established itself as a prominent player in the low-carbon propulsion market, offering a wide range of eco-friendly transportation solutions.
- Hyundai Motor Company: Hyundai is actively investing in hydrogen fuel cell technology and electric vehicles, aiming to provide customers with diverse low-carbon propulsion options to reduce emissions and promote sustainable mobility.
